Classic, Elegant Roofing Shingle
CertainTeed’s Highland Slate shingles offer several advantages for Long Island homes. These impact resistant shingles emulate the classic appearance, dark shadow lines, and tone of natural slate but are crafted from more durable and less expensive asphalt roofing shingles. Highland Slate shingles are available in a variety of colors, including Black Granite, Fieldstone, New England Slate, Smoky Quartz, Tudor Brown, and Weathered Wood, allowing homeowners to choose a color that complements their home’s architectural styles.
Highland Slate shingles have a Class A fire resistance rating for superior protection. The shingles’ heavy weight construction and can withstand winds up to 110 MPH, with a 130 MPH wind rating upgrade option. Their 25-year StreakFighter algae resistance warranty is particularly beneficial in humid shore climates where algae growth can be a concern. A Brief History of Slate Roofs
Slate roofs have a long and rich history, dating back centuries. Their popularity stemmed from the natural beauty and rugged protection of slate tiles. Quarried from the earth, slate offered a unique blend of elegance and resilience, capable of withstanding harsh weather conditions and lasting for generations. Historic buildings adorned with slate roofs have an enduring appeal and timeless sophistication. Even today, the classic look of a slate roof evokes a sense of quality and craftsmanship that few other roofing materials can match.
However, despite their undeniable beauty and longevity, slate roofs present some significant drawbacks for contemporary homeowners. Slate tiles are incredibly heavy, often requiring additional structural support that can add to the cost and complexity of installation. They also demand specialized installation techniques, necessitating the expertise of skilled roofers who are experienced in working with slate. Perhaps the biggest deterrent for many homeowners is the cost. Slate roofs are significantly more expensive than most other roofing alternatives, making them a luxury that’s often out of reach for the average homeowner.

The Look of Slate, the Convenience of Asphalt
Highland Slate’s large format four-across tab design replicates the craggy, chiseled form of real quarried slate while giving you the convenience and added benefit of asphalt shingles.
CertainTeed’s Shangle Ridge® hip and ridge accessories complement Highland State shingles. You can also accent your Highland Slate roof with Cedar Crest®. Cedar Crest hip and ridge accessories feature blended colors and a striking dimensional appearance that provides maximum curb appeal.
Certainteed’s Flintlastic® SA lets you coordinate flat roof areas like carports, canopies and porches with your main roof. These self-adhering peel and stick roof membranes are less expensive than full multilayer roof options. But they still offer up to 25 years of warranty protection.

More Information about Highland Slate Shingles
SPECIFICATIONS
-
- Single-layer fiber glass-based construction
- Authentic depth and dimension of natural slate
-
- Algae resistant
-
- 110 mph wind warranty Upgrade to 130 MPH available
-
- Lifetime-limited warranty
Fire Resistance
-
- UL certified to meet ASTM D3018, Type 1 • UL 790 Class
- ASTM E 108 Class A
Wind Resistance
-
- UL 2390/ASTM D 6381 Class H
- ASTM D3161 Class F
Tear Resistance
-
- UL certified to meet ASTM D3462
- CSA standard A123.5
WARRANTY
- Lifetime limited transferable warranty against manufacturing defects on residential applications
- 50-year limited transferable warranties against manufacturing defects on group owned or commercial applications
- 15-year algae-resistance warranty
- 10-year SureStartTM protection
- 15-year 110 MPH wind resistant warranty
- Upgrade to 130 MPH available CertainTeed starter and CertainTeed hip & ridge required
